首页
/ Kubeshark登录失败问题深度分析与解决方案

Kubeshark登录失败问题深度分析与解决方案

2025-05-20 14:29:26作者:尤峻淳Whitney

问题背景

Kubeshark作为一款Kubernetes流量分析工具,近期有用户反馈在通过Microsoft账户或邮箱登录时出现验证失败问题。该问题主要表现为:

  1. 使用Microsoft账户登录时,系统未完成完整的账户验证流程
  2. 中国地区(+86)手机号无法接收验证码
  3. 两种登录方式均返回相同的错误提示

技术分析

验证流程中断问题

根据开发团队的技术诊断,该问题源于OAuth 2.0授权流程中的验证环节未完整执行。具体表现为:

  • 用户通过Microsoft身份提供商(IdP)进行认证时
  • 系统未能正确完成email验证步骤
  • 导致账户注册流程在最后阶段中断

短信服务限制

针对中国地区手机号无法接收验证码的问题,经排查发现:

  1. 当前短信服务提供商对中国区(+86)号码存在发送限制
  2. 可能涉及国际短信通道的稳定性问题
  3. 未触发运营商的短信防火墙机制

解决方案

临时解决方案

对于急需使用产品的用户,推荐采用以下替代方案:

  1. 通过邮件联系技术支持获取个人许可证密钥
  2. 将许可证密钥配置到Kubeshark的配置文件中
  3. 这种方式可以绕过登录验证直接使用产品功能

配置许可证密钥

获取许可证后,需要进行如下配置:

# kubeshark-config.yaml
license:
  key: "您的许可证密钥"

长期解决方案建议

  1. 检查并完善OAuth集成中的验证回调处理
  2. 考虑增加备用短信服务提供商
  3. 实现邮件验证的备用验证通道
  4. 优化错误日志记录以便快速定位问题

最佳实践建议

  1. 在尝试登录前,确保浏览器未安装可能干扰OAuth流程的插件
  2. 可尝试使用隐身模式进行登录测试
  3. 保持客户端工具为最新版本
  4. 如遇持续性问题,建议收集浏览器控制台日志供技术支持分析

总结

Kubernetes生态工具的身份验证机制需要处理复杂的网络环境和地区差异。Kubeshark团队正在积极优化其认证流程,同时提供了灵活的许可证机制确保用户不受登录问题影响。建议用户关注官方更新以获取最新的认证方式改进。

登录后查看全文
热门项目推荐
相关项目推荐